Some Easy-Peasy Mask Ideas
Ready to get your mask on? Here are a few super simple ideas to get you started:
- Honey and Oatmeal: For soothing and moisturizing. Just mix equal parts honey and cooked oatmeal. Seriously, that’s it!
- Avocado and Yogurt: Hydrating and nourishing. Mash half an avocado and mix with a tablespoon of plain yogurt.
- Lemon and Honey: Brightening and exfoliating (use sparingly if you have sensitive skin!). Mix a teaspoon of lemon juice with a tablespoon of honey.
Remember to always do a patch test on a small area of skin before applying the mask to your whole face, just to be safe! And always listen to your skin. If something feels irritating, wash it off immediately.
